Simple & Budget-Friendly 3-Course Wedding Menu Ideas

Mississauga Jul 01, 2026

Planning a wedding on a budget doesn't mean you have to compromise on quality, especially when it comes to your wedding menu. A simple yet elegant three-course menu can leave a lasting impression on your guests without breaking the bank. Let's explore some budget-friendly ideas that will make your special day unforgettable.

Starter Course: Appetizers and Soups

Kickstart your wedding feast with a delightful appetizer or a comforting soup. These options are not only delicious but also cost-effective, allowing you to stretch your budget further.

Consider serving a classic bruschetta with a twist. Use day-old bread, top it with a mixture of diced tomatoes, garlic, basil, and a drizzle of olive oil, then add a sprinkle of balsamic glaze for a touch of elegance. This dish is not only visually appealing but also easy on the wallet.

Set up a crostini bar with an assortment of toppings like ricotta and honey, prosciutto and melon, or smoked salmon and cream cheese. This interactive station encourages guests to mingle while enjoying their appetizers, and it's a budget-friendly option as you can buy ingredients in bulk and portion them out.

Another cost-effective option is serving a hearty soup. A large pot of minestrone or tomato basil soup can feed a crowd and warm their hearts. Pair it with some crusty bread and a simple green salad for a satisfying starter course.

Mushroom Soup

Mushroom soup is a versatile and affordable option that can be made ahead of time and reheated. To elevate this dish, use a mix of mushrooms for depth of flavor, and garnish with a drizzle of truffle oil or a sprinkle of chopped fresh herbs.

Don't forget to consider your guests' dietary restrictions when planning your starter course. Offer a vegetarian or vegan option, such as a roasted red pepper and tomato soup or a cold cucumber avocado soup, to ensure everyone can enjoy the meal.

Main Course: Entrees and Sides

The main course is the centerpiece of your wedding menu, and there are plenty of budget-friendly options that will satisfy your guests' appetites.

One popular and affordable option is serving a family-style meal. This approach allows you to offer a variety of dishes at a lower cost per person. Consider serving a roasted chicken or a slow-cooked pot roast as the main attraction, accompanied by an assortment of sides like mashed potatoes, roasted vegetables, and a simple green salad.

Sheet Pan Dinners

Sheet pan dinners are not only trendy but also budget-friendly. Prepare a one-pan wonder like lemon herb chicken with potatoes and vegetables or a spicy sausage and vegetable bake. These dishes are easy to prepare in bulk and can be served family-style, making them an excellent choice for a wedding menu.

Another cost-effective option is serving a pasta dish as the main course. Choose a hearty, budget-friendly pasta like penne or rigatoni, and pair it with a simple tomato sauce or a creamy Alfredo sauce. Add some protein like ground beef or chicken, and you have a satisfying and affordable main dish.

Stuffed Bell Peppers

Stuffed bell peppers are a delicious and budget-friendly option that can be made ahead of time and reheated. Fill the peppers with a mixture of cooked rice, ground beef or turkey, and your favorite vegetables, then top with a sprinkle of cheese before serving.

Don't forget to offer a variety of sides to complement your main course. Roasted vegetables, garlic bread, and a simple green salad are all affordable options that can be prepared in bulk. Consider setting up a DIY side dish station where guests can customize their plates with their favorite combinations.

Dessert Course: Sweet Treats and Cakes

No wedding menu is complete without a sweet treat to cap off the meal. There are plenty of budget-friendly dessert options that will satisfy your guests' sweet tooth without breaking the bank.

One popular and affordable option is serving a dessert bar featuring an assortment of mini treats like cupcakes, cookies, and macarons. This approach allows guests to sample a variety of sweets and is a fun and interactive way to end the meal.

DIY Dessert Bar

Set up a DIY dessert bar with an assortment of sweet treats and toppings like whipped cream, fresh berries, and chocolate sauce. This interactive station encourages guests to create their own desserts and is a budget-friendly option as you can buy ingredients in bulk and portion them out.

Another cost-effective option is serving a classic wedding cake. Choose a simple, elegant design and opt for a smaller cake with a larger sheet cake hidden in the back. This approach allows you to have the best of both worlds – a stunning cake for photos and a more affordable option for serving your guests.

Naked Cake

A naked cake is a stylish and budget-friendly alternative to a traditional frosted cake. This rustic-chic dessert features a cake with minimal frosting, allowing the natural beauty of the cake layers to shine through. Decorate the cake with fresh flowers, berries, or greenery for a touch of elegance.

Don't forget to consider your guests' dietary restrictions when planning your dessert course. Offer a vegetarian or vegan option, such as a fruit crisp or a chocolate mousse, to ensure everyone can enjoy the sweet treats.
